Despite the rise of digital payments, checks continue to play a significant role in financial transactions across the United States. Entities such as small businesses, nonprofits, landlords, and individuals still utilize checks for various purposes including rent payments, vendor payouts, donations, and official documentation. Consequently, efficient and secure check printing solutions have become increasingly valuable in today’s financial environment.
Checks offer a tangible record of payment that many banks, institutions, and recipients trust. Unlike cash, checks provide traceability, and unlike some digital payments, they do not always require immediate online access. For businesses, checks are especially useful for managing accounts payable, maintaining audit trails, and handling bulk payments without excessive transaction fees.
Traditional check ordering from banks can be expensive and slow, leading many users to explore alternative check printing software that provides flexibility, cost savings, and faster turnaround times.
Key Features of Check Printing Software
When selecting a check printing solution, functionality and security should be prioritized. Optimal platforms typically offer customizable templates, compatibility with common accounting software, and compliance with banking standards such as MICR encoding. These features ensure that printed checks are accepted without delays or errors.
Ease of use is another important consideration. Software that integrates seamlessly with accounting tools like QuickBooks or Excel can significantly reduce manual data entry and minimize mistakes. This not only saves time but also improves overall financial accuracy.

An advantage of using third-party check printing tools is cost control. Instead of paying premium prices for pre-printed checks from banks, users can print checks on demand using blank check stock. This approach reduces waste, allows for immediate reprints if errors occur, and gives users full control over their check inventory.

Security is a critical factor in check printing. High-quality software includes features like password protection, check number tracking, and fraud-deterrent design elements. Some systems also support encrypted data storage and controlled user access, which is especially important for businesses handling sensitive financial information.
Compliance with bank requirements is equally important. Checks must include accurate routing numbers, account numbers, and standardized layouts to ensure smooth processing. Reliable software helps users meet these requirements without needing specialized printing knowledge.
Check printing solutions are suitable for a wide range of users. Small businesses benefit from faster vendor payments and streamlined bookkeeping. Nonprofits appreciate the ability to issue donations and grants efficiently. Even individuals find value in printing occasional checks without visiting a bank or waiting for mailed checkbooks.
